ParameterMetaData
JDBC. Документацию по этому классу см. в java.sql.ParameterMetaData
.
Методы
Подробная документация
getParameterClassName(param)
Документацию по этому методу см. в java.sql.ParameterMetaData#getParameterClassName(int)
.
Параметры
Имя | Тип | Описание |
---|---|---|
param | Integer | Индекс параметра для проверки. Первый параметр имеет индекс 1. |
Возвращаться
String
— полное имя класса Java, используемое методами JdbcPreparedStatement.setObject(index, x)
.
Авторизация
Сценарии, использующие этот метод, требуют авторизации с одной или несколькими из следующих областей :
-
https://www.googleapis.com/auth/script.external_request
getParameterCount()
Документацию по этому методу см. в java.sql.ParameterMetaData#getParameterCount()
.
Возвращаться
Integer
— количество параметров, информацию о которых содержат эти метаданные.
Авторизация
Сценарии, использующие этот метод, требуют авторизации с одной или несколькими из следующих областей :
-
https://www.googleapis.com/auth/script.external_request
getParameterMode(param)
Документацию по этому методу см. в java.sql.ParameterMetaData#getParameterMode(int)
.
Параметры
Имя | Тип | Описание |
---|---|---|
param | Integer | Индекс параметра для проверки. Первый параметр имеет индекс 1. |
Возвращаться
Integer
— назначенный режим параметра, который является одним из Jdbc.ParameterMetaData.parameterModeIn
, Jdbc.ParameterMetaData.parameterModeOut
, Jdbc.ParameterMetaData.parameterModeInOut
или Jdbc.ParameterMetaData.parameterModeUnknown
.
Авторизация
Сценарии, использующие этот метод, требуют авторизации с одной или несколькими из следующих областей :
-
https://www.googleapis.com/auth/script.external_request
getParameterType(param)
Документацию по этому методу см. в java.sql.ParameterMetaData#getParameterType(int)
.
Параметры
Имя | Тип | Описание |
---|---|---|
param | Integer | Индекс параметра для проверки. Первый параметр имеет индекс 1. |
Возвращаться
Integer
— тип SQL назначенного параметра.
Авторизация
Сценарии, использующие этот метод, требуют авторизации с одной или несколькими из следующих областей :
-
https://www.googleapis.com/auth/script.external_request
getParameterTypeName(param)
Документацию по этому методу см. в java.sql.ParameterMetaData#getParameterTypeName(int)
.
Параметры
Имя | Тип | Описание |
---|---|---|
param | Integer | Индекс параметра для проверки. Первый параметр имеет индекс 1. |
Возвращаться
String
— имя типа назначенного параметра, зависящее от базы данных. Это полное имя типа, если параметр является типом, определяемым пользователем.
Авторизация
Сценарии, использующие этот метод, требуют авторизации с одной или несколькими из следующих областей :
-
https://www.googleapis.com/auth/script.external_request
getPrecision(param)
Документацию по этому методу см. в java.sql.ParameterMetaData#getPrecision(int)
.
Параметры
Имя | Тип | Описание |
---|---|---|
param | Integer | Индекс параметра для проверки. Первый параметр имеет индекс 1. |
Возвращаться
Integer
— максимальный размер столбца для данного параметра. Для числовых данных это максимальная точность. Для символьных данных это длина в символах. Для данных даты и времени это длина строкового представления в символах (при условии максимально допустимой точности компонента доли секунды). Для двоичных данных это длина в байтах. Для типа данных ROWID
это длина в байтах. Возвращает 0 для типов, для которых размер столбца неприменим.
Авторизация
Сценарии, использующие этот метод, требуют авторизации с одной или несколькими из следующих областей :
-
https://www.googleapis.com/auth/script.external_request
getScale(param)
Документацию по этому методу см. в java.sql.ParameterMetaData#getScale(int)
.
Параметры
Имя | Тип | Описание |
---|---|---|
param | Integer | Индекс параметра для проверки. Первый параметр имеет индекс 1. |
Возвращаться
Integer
— количество цифр назначенного параметра справа от десятичной точки. Возвращает 0 для типов данных, к которым масштаб неприменим.
Авторизация
Сценарии, использующие этот метод, требуют авторизации с одной или несколькими из следующих областей :
-
https://www.googleapis.com/auth/script.external_request
isNullable(param)
Документацию по этому методу см. в java.sql.ParameterMetaData#isNullable(int)
.
Параметры
Имя | Тип | Описание |
---|---|---|
param | Integer | Индекс параметра для проверки. Первый параметр имеет индекс 1. |
Возвращаться
Integer
— Статус обнуления данного параметра; один из Jdbc.ParameterMetaData.parameterNoNulls
, Jdbc.ParameterMetaData.parameterNullable
или Jdbc.ParameterMetaData.parameterNullableUnknown
.
Авторизация
Сценарии, использующие этот метод, требуют авторизации с одной или несколькими из следующих областей :
-
https://www.googleapis.com/auth/script.external_request
isSigned(param)
Документацию по этому методу см. в java.sql.ParameterMetaData#isSigned(int)
.
Параметры
Имя | Тип | Описание |
---|---|---|
param | Integer | Индекс параметра для проверки. Первый параметр имеет индекс 1. |
Возвращаться
Boolean
— true
, если указанный параметр может принимать числовые значения со знаком; false
в противном случае.
Авторизация
Сценарии, использующие этот метод, требуют авторизации с одной или несколькими из следующих областей :
-
https://www.googleapis.com/auth/script.external_request